Facade Frontiers: Advancement in Architecture's Envelope

The architectural facade is undergoing a revolution. No longer merely a protective barrier, it has evolved into a dynamic and expressive element, pushing the boundaries of design and technology. This evolution is driven by a desire to create buildings that are not only visually striking but also environmentally conscious, responsive to their surroundings, and imbued with a sense of place.

From adaptive materials that react to sunlight and temperature to intricately patterned facades that mimic natural textures, architects are exploring new possibilities in the realm of facade design. These innovative approaches offer a glimpse into the future of architecture, where buildings become more than just structures; they become breathing entities that interact with their inhabitants and the urban landscape.

  • Advanced technologies like 3D printing and robotics are enabling architects to create complex facade designs with unprecedented precision and detail.
  • Green materials, such as reclaimed wood and recycled glass, are being incorporated into facades to reduce the environmental impact of construction.
  • Dynamic facades that change color or texture based on factors like sunlight or temperature create a captivating and ever-evolving aesthetic.

Constructing Beyond Functionality: Aesthetics and Performance in Facade Design

Facade design has a unique opportunity for architects. Traditionally, facades had been primarily focused on practicality, ensuring the edifice was weatherproof and safe. However, in modern architectural realm, there is a growing trend on integrating aesthetics with performance.

Designers are now seeking facades that not only meet their functional needs but also elevate the aesthetic appeal of a building.

This evolution is driven by several influences. The rise of green building practices has made energy-efficient facades more desirable.

Additionally, city environments are becoming increasingly dense, and aesthetically pleasing facades can play a role to the overall liveability of a city.

Moreover, the desire for buildings that are unique has risen. Aesthetics and performance are no longer seen as distinct entities, but rather as connected aspects of a successful facade design.

Combining these two elements requires a deep understanding of both the practical and aesthetic aspects of a building. Architects must carefully evaluate factors such as materials, illumination, texture, color, and shape to design facades that are not only effective but also artistically compelling.

Crafting the Cityscape: A Guide to Windows & Facade Construction

The skyline is a symphony of architectural styles and materials, where each component contributes to its overall aesthetic appeal. Windows and facades play a crucial role in this composition, shaping not only the visual character but also the functionality and energy efficiency of buildings.

A well-designed facade augments both the curb appeal and structural integrity of a building, providing protection from the elements while reflecting the unique personality of its occupants. Choosing the right materials and construction techniques is paramount to achieving a facade that is both durable and visually striking.

Windows are more than just openings; they bathe interior spaces with natural light, creating inviting and comfortable environments. Modern window technologies prioritize energy efficiency, reducing heat loss in winter and gain in summer, ultimately contributing to a more sustainable built environment.

From sleek glass panels to intricate masonry designs, the possibilities for facade construction are vast and varied. Understanding the fundamentals of building design and materials science is essential for architects, engineers, and contractors to create facades that are not only aesthetically pleasing but also functional and resilient.
